The Sun

Edvard Munch · 1911 · University of Oslo
The Sun

The artist

Edvard Munch, a Norwegian painter best known for expressing strong feelings through bold color.

What you see

A huge, bright sun rising over the sea and rocks, sending rays of light shooting across the whole picture.

The story

Munch painted it around 1911 for the Great Hall of the University of Oslo to celebrate light and knowledge.

The style

He used bursting lines of yellow, orange, and blue so the sunlight seems to explode and spread out toward you.

Look closer

There are no people in this painting, only the powerful sun, making the light itself feel like the main character.

Where to see it

You can see it in the Aula, the grand ceremonial hall, at the University of Oslo in Norway.

Fun fact

This cheerful sun comes from the same artist who painted The Scream, showing his brighter, hopeful side.
